## Formula sandbox tuning

User-supplied formulas in Gridmoor execute inside a restricted interpreter with hard ceilings on time, memory, and call depth. Reviewers should confirm any change to these ceilings is justified in the PR description, since raising them widens the abuse surface. Defaults were chosen from production traces. The current limits are as follows.

limits module of tafog-fawip:
WEIGHTS = {
    "julix": 57,
    "lamys": 992,
    "kasvan": 209,
    "quenok": 750,
    "alddor": 259,
    "oliath": 1009,
    "wenix": 815,
}

## Env Vars: Broker Upgrade (Tollhaven v4)

Support team: during the Tollhaven v4 broker upgrade, clients on the old wire protocol will see reconnect loops until their env files are updated. Confirm BROKER_PROTOCOL=v4 and BROKER_HOSTSET points at the new Greymarsh pool before advising a restart. Heartbeat intervals tightened to 15s, so stale configs fail fast rather than hanging. The v4 handshake also requires an authentication token issued per environment, and that token belongs on the very next line of the env file.

vault entry, kagep-yajeg: COURIER_KEY5=da097

Meeting notes — dispatch huddle, Tuesday

Quick one: the pallet of recalled Voltbee chargers is still sitting in bay 3. Marla from Greyfen Retail wants it gone this week, no exceptions. Courier from Swifthollow is booked for Thursday morning. Don't let anyone sign it out early. For the hand-over itself, follow the confidential instruction below.

dispatch memo: the eliath belael courier leaves the praox ledger at gate 8841 under passcode 017589

**Night-Shift Access — Support Team, Garnet House**

Support staff cover 22:00–06:00. Main doors lock at 21:30; use the east stairwell entrance only. Sign the night register at the security hutch on arrival and departure. No visitors after midnight without prior clearance from facilities. Fire exits must stay clear at all times. The east stairwell keypad takes the code below.

door code, baguf-hafop: bdg-XVZNJX-34075274